« Reply #23 on: February 09, 2018, 10:47:52 am »
Thank you very much for this. Much appreciated.
It has been working stable for me, since I am using it.
Also regarding the VLAN. No matter if I set that on Opnsense or on the modem. There is no difference. Both does work for me.
Just one thing, I had recognized, but did not look deaper into it. When I boot my opnsense box, the IGMP Proxy has to start before the Open VPN Server is starting. Else somehow the IGMP Proxy Service doesnt start on my box.
Might be something on my box. So far, when I boot up my box, I just did stop that OpenVPN Server, then start the IGMP Proxy and after that start the OpenVPN Server.

Re: [SOLVED] Please update igmpproxy
« Reply #26 on: March 14, 2018, 06:14:14 pm »
igmpproxy 0.1 project was discontinued a few years ago and we had manual patches. igmpproxy 0.2 is a new fork, we likely have to redo a few things with the author, see the other thread.
